T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- The Financial Services Authority (OJK) recorded over 30.27 million capital market investors under Single Investor Identification (SID) as of August 7, 2026. This number reflected a 48.67 percent year-on-year growth, with a surge of approximately 9.8 million investors compared to the same period the previous year.
Friderica Widyasari Dewi, Chairperson of the OJK Board of Commissioners, said the investor growth is attributed to OJK's capital market integrity reforms.
"Indeed, this figure reflects more than just numbers, but also the underlying meaning: the trust, confidence, and hope Indonesians have in the Indonesian capital market," Friderica stated in a press release on Monday, August 10, 2026.
According to her, the majority of capital market investors are young, with around 78 percent in total under 40 years old. This, she said, demonstrated the growing participation of the younger generation in investing in the Indonesian capital market.
OJK also recorded over Rp123.21 trillion in capital market inflows as of August 7, 2026, from 135 corporate actions, while the number of issuers in the Indonesian capital market has exceeded 962 companies.
During the same period, the Net Asset Value (NAV) of mutual funds reached Rp667 trillion, while the value of assets under management (AUM) reached Rp1,026 trillion.
Furthermore, in commemoration of the 49th anniversary of the Capital Market, the OJK launched a gold Exchange Traded Fund (ETF) as a new investment product traded on the stock exchange. This product is one of the achievements of the Financial Services Authority's eight action plans within the integrated market deepening agenda.
Gold ETFs offer a practical and liquid investment alternative and can be used as a diversification instrument. These products are also developed in accordance with Sharia principles and are expected to contribute to expanding the precious metals market ecosystem through collaboration between institutions and industry players.
Hasan Fawzi, Chief Executive of the Capital Market, Financial Derivatives, and Carbon Exchange Supervision at OJK, stated that the presence of gold mutual funds or ETFs is expected to strengthen capital market stability by diversifying instruments and investment options for investors.
